  3. Get your Guardian set bonus first since it will increase your DPS more from reducing the downtime of having to use Strike. You should have the 2 piece Guardian and Sentinel set bonuses ideally. Just don't use the accuracy and crit enhancements. You should be pulling the armoring out of the medium armor pieces anyway and use adaptive or heavy armor gear. Your increased damage reduction is one of the reasons Guardians can be good to bring to a raid. Short answer: You should have both 2 piece bonuses eventually so get which ever one you want first. Guardian set bonus should give higher dps gain though.

  13. It is also very much fight specific. If you have target swaps often then DF falls behind SS. If you can sit in one place and not have to worry about many other mechanics or you know how to manage uptime and can keep your damage doing then DF may pull ahead. SS is also proc reliant, whereas DF is not. There are many factors that come down to if one class or spec is better then another.
